Perennial Champion Kling To Lighten Coaching Load:

For as long as anyone can remember, there’s been Bud Kling and there’s been championships in tennis at Palisades High.

 But when the Dolphins won their third straight LA City championship last season it ended Kling’s run with the girls team.

 The man who has guided more than 30 Palisades championship teams will return next season as coach of the boys team.

 Senior Katy Nikolova of Palisades won the girls individual championship for the second straight time.
